First and foremost, proper grip alignment is essential in avoiding a hook. Make sure you use a neutral grip that allows your hands and arms to roll freely through impact with the ball.

Let your right wrist go from extended to … WebCure: “Neutralize” your grip -- Check your hand position by gripping the club and addressing the ball, then looking at the knuckles on your left hand. If you can clearly see three or more, your grip is too strong. Rotate the hands left …
